About A. Chibani

A. Chibani is a scholar working on Control and Systems Engineering, Electrical and Electronic Engineering, Statistical and Nonlinear Physics, Geometry and Topology and Artificial Intelligence, having authored 19 papers that have together received 359 indexed citations. Recurring topics across this work include Advanced DC-DC Converters (10 papers), Multilevel Inverters and Converters (8 papers), Stability and Control of Uncertain Systems (8 papers), Adaptive Control of Nonlinear Systems (6 papers), Silicon Carbide Semiconductor Technologies (4 papers), Fault Detection and Control Systems (3 papers), Fuzzy Logic and Control Systems (3 papers) and Advanced Control Systems Design (2 papers). The work is most often cited by research in Control and Systems Engineering (297 citations), Computer Networks and Communications (81 citations), Artificial Intelligence (87 citations), Automotive Engineering (25 citations) and Computational Mathematics (1 citation). A. Chibani has collaborated with scholars based in Japan, Tunisia and France. Frequent co-authors include Mohammed Chadli, Naceur Benhadj Braïek, Peng Shi, M. Nakaoka, Steven X. Ding, K. Hirachi, Koki Nishimura, Peng Shi, Mohamed Moez Belhaouane and G.J. Yu. Their work appears in journals such as IEEE Transactions on Fuzzy Systems, Automatica, Asian Journal of Control, International Journal of Modelling Identification and Control and IFAC-PapersOnLine.
